Animal Rights Activism: A Moral-Sociological Perspective on Social Movements - Protest and Social Movements
Kerstin Jacobsson
The authors use the animal rights movement in Sweden to offer the first analysis of social movements through the lens of Emile Durkheim's sociology of morality
